    Ceiling fan won't spin
    I have a mercator grange ceiling fan and last night it made a loud noise and now won't spin. The light still comes on and it's getting power. It makes a terrible noise if the fan is turned on. It was put in by a licensed electrician. Any advice would be most appreciated.

    Bad bearing in the fan motor, shorted armature, something broke that is stopping the motor. See if it spins freely when pushed by hand.

    Thanks for your fast reply ma0641. Yes it still spins freely when pushed by hand

    Sounds like an electrical issue if it spins by hand. Most ceiling fans are capacitor start and you may be hearing the motor struggle if the cap is bad. Unfortunately fans are so discounted these days by HD and Lowe's, it doesn't pay to repair.
